Philips 639
This model combines the body of Philips 330 and functional capabilities of
Philips 350. It has outer monochrome display.
- Class: fashion
- Position in the line: above Philips
630
- Rival phones: Motorola
v150
- Description based on preliminary information
- General features
- Announced in November 2003, in the market since February-March 2004
- GSM 900/1800
- Battery type Li-Ion 720 mAh
- Standby time up to 230 hours, talk time up to 4 hours 30 minutes
- TFT display shows up to 65000 colors, 5 text lines and two service ones,
has the resolution of 128x128 pixels (28x28 mm)
- Outer display with the resolution of 80x48 pixels, built in mirror surface
- Attached VGA camera
- Up to 8 different body colors
- Dimensions: 79 x 43 x 18,5 mm
- Weight: 75 g
- Memory
- Phone book memory for 300 names, allows to set up to 5 numbers and one e-mail
address for a name
- Users' groups in a phone book, a possibility to assign own melody for
different users' groups. A possibility to assign a photo for a group,
it will be displayed during incoming call (Fotocall). Up to 20 groups
- Orgainzer memory for 300 events, memory is shared with the phone book,
that means if a number of notes in organizer is 100 then a number of names in the
phone book cannot be more than 200.
- 2 MB of memory for dictaphone records and files are also shared dynamically,
450 KB are used at the begining
- Call management, ringing tones
- Vibrating alert
- 32 tones polyphony
- 30 melodies and ringing tones, a possibility to create own melody
- A new voice code AMR in addition to three ones(HR, FR,EFR).
- A possibility to use 40 voice marks for voice dialing or accessing menu items
- SMS
- Predictive text input T9
- SMS, EMS
- 10 templates
- Connectivity
- WAP 2.0
- GPRS(4+2)
- e-mail(POP/SMTP) - up to two accounts
- MMS
- Organizer and extras
- Graphic image or clock like headband
- BeDJ
- Java - it is possible that Java support will be added in the first quarter of 2004
- Orgainzer for up to 300 events. Calendar - week or month view, recurrent events
- Date, time, alarm-clock
- Calculator, currency converter
- Dictaphone, number and length of notes are limited only by free space
- Game - Bricks
